Как найти Blockchain разработчика в IT-компанию | ITExpert

Поиск Blockchain-разработчика

Blockchain-сфера продолжает активно развиваться. Согласно прогнозам*, к 2030 году мировой рынок блокчейна достигнет $1,2 млрд с общим годовым темпом роста почти в 83%. Поэтому разработчики Blockchain продолжают пользоваться высоким спросом, а найти скиллового специалиста — задача не из легких.

При самостоятельном поиске вам необходимо разобраться в технических деталях, мониторить различные чаты и группы с потенциальными кандидатами, учитывать ограничения рынка, а также всячески жонглировать бенефитами, чтобы заинтересовать квалифицированных разработчиков.

Узнайте в деталях, blockchain developer — что это за специалист, какими скиллами он обладает, как правильно написать кандидату, а также к каким челленджам стоит подготовиться при самостоятельном найме и как вам рекрутинговое агентство поможет их решить.

Кто такой блокчейн-разработчик и чем он занимается?

Блокчейн — технология, которая впервые стала популярной благодаря биткоину. Второй крупный прорыв произошел с появлением Ethereum и смарт-контрактами. Это открыло двери для различных вариантов использования, основные из которых — DeFi, отслеживание цепочки поставок и использование ценных активов в играх, VR и совместном создании контента.

Blockchain developer — это специалист, который создает методы сбора и хранения данных — так, чтобы предотвратить их изменения или действия хакеров, а также обеспечить безопасные цифровые транзакции. Он обладает знаниями и опытом, необходимыми для создания и улучшения децентрализованных приложений (dApps) и смарт-контрактов на основе блокчейна, а также архитектуры и протоколов блокчейна.

Must-have скиллы разработчика на Blockchain

На какие навыки важно обратить внимание, чтобы нанять опытного специалиста в Blockchain — рассказываем далее.

Знание базовой технологии распределенного реестра (DLT)

Любой специалист по блокчейну должен хорошо знать строительные блоки, из которых состоит сеть блокчейна, включая систему распределенных узлов, алгоритмы консенсуса, спецификации хранения и потенциальные векторы уязвимости.

Смарт-контракты 

Для многих бизнес-моделей блокчейна важно интегрировать смарт-контракты в свои системы. Убедитесь, что ваш будущий разработчик хорошо разбирается в смарт-контрактах, которые позволяют сторонам выполнять транзакции.

Объектно-ориентированное программирование

Разработка блокчейна опирается на принципы ООП, которые помогают находить эффективные решения сложных задач. Поэтому выбирайте разработчиков Blockchain с опытом устранения неполадок полиморфизма и модульности.

Один из поддерживаемых языков программирования и фреймворки

Нанимая Blockchain-разработчика, проверьте, что он владеет нужным языком программирования, чтобы он мог плавно интегрировать блокчейн-функции с остальной частью вашего приложения. Среди возможных вариантов:

Blockchain-сфера продолжает активно развиваться. Согласно прогнозам*, к 2030 году мировой рынок блокчейна достигнет $1,2 млрд с общим годовым темпом роста почти в 83%. Поэтому разработчики Blockchain продолжают пользоваться высоким спросом, а найти скиллового специалиста — задача не из легких.

При самостоятельном поиске вам необходимо разобраться в технических деталях, мониторить различные чаты и группы с потенциальными кандидатами, учитывать ограничения рынка, а также всячески жонглировать бенефитами, чтобы заинтересовать квалифицированных разработчиков.

Узнайте в деталях, blockchain developer — что это за специалист, какими скиллами он обладает, как правильно написать кандидату, а также к каким челленджам стоит подготовиться при самостоятельном найме и как вам рекрутинговое агентство поможет их решить.

Кто такой блокчейн-разработчик и чем он занимается?

Блокчейн — технология, которая впервые стала популярной благодаря биткоину. Второй крупный прорыв произошел с появлением Ethereum и смарт-контрактами. Это открыло двери для различных вариантов использования, основные из которых — DeFi, отслеживание цепочки поставок и использование ценных активов в играх, VR и совместном создании контента.

Blockchain developer — это специалист, который создает методы сбора и хранения данных — так, чтобы предотвратить их изменения или действия хакеров, а также обеспечить безопасные цифровые транзакции. Он обладает знаниями и опытом, необходимыми для создания и улучшения децентрализованных приложений (dApps) и смарт-контрактов на основе блокчейна, а также архитектуры и протоколов блокчейна.

Must-have скиллы разработчика на Blockchain

На какие навыки важно обратить внимание, чтобы нанять опытного специалиста в Blockchain — рассказываем далее.

Знание базовой технологии распределенного реестра (DLT)

Любой специалист по блокчейну должен хорошо знать строительные блоки, из которых состоит сеть блокчейна, включая систему распределенных узлов, алгоритмы консенсуса, спецификации хранения и потенциальные векторы уязвимости.

Смарт-контракты 

Для многих бизнес-моделей блокчейна важно интегрировать смарт-контракты в свои системы. Убедитесь, что ваш будущий разработчик хорошо разбирается в смарт-контрактах, которые позволяют сторонам выполнять транзакции.

Объектно-ориентированное программирование

Разработка блокчейна опирается на принципы ООП, которые помогают находить эффективные решения сложных задач. Поэтому выбирайте разработчиков Blockchain с опытом устранения неполадок полиморфизма и модульности.

Один из поддерживаемых языков программирования и фреймворки

Нанимая Blockchain-разработчика, проверьте, что он владеет нужным языком программирования, чтобы он мог плавно интегрировать блокчейн-функции с остальной частью вашего приложения. Среди возможных вариантов:

  • Solidity — самый широко распространенный и надежный язык для разработки блокчейн-решений. Он специально создан для смарт-контрактов на Ethereum (EVM), объединяет возможности Java, C++ и PowerShell.
  • Rust — второй популярный язык для разработки блокчейн-приложений. Отлично подходит как для стартапов, так и для крупных проектов, как для встраиваемых устройств, так и для масштабируемых web-сервисов.
  • JavaScript — язык обладает обширным интерфейсом API и включает в себя множество классов, пакетов и интерфейсов, которые программист может использовать в своих приложениях.
  • Java — играет важную роль в разработке таких известных блокчейн-платформ, как Ethereum, Hyperledger Fabric, IOTA, NEO и других, часто используется блокчейн-разработчиками.
  • Golang — известный своим удобством, скоростью и гибкостью. Заметные достижения Golang в блокчейн-сфере включают разработки Go-Ethereum и Hyperledger Fabric.

Николай Клестов фото
Николай Клестов
CTO и co-founder в ITExpert

«Кроме зарплаты, для кандидатов в блокчейн-сфере важен и сам проект — чтобы это было не что-то созданное на хайпе, а создавалось впечатление уникальности, важности проекта. И, конечно, критичным становится надежное финансирование продукта. Настоящий челлендж — показать, что у специалиста будут гарантии на проекте и возможность долговременного сотрудничества».

Распределенные системы

Для разработки приложений специалисту по блокчейну необходимо четкое представление об одноранговых сетях и распределенных системах.

Свяжитесь с нами уже сейчас
Заказать консультацию

Челленджи в найме Blockchain-разработчиков

Почему самостоятельный найм блокчейн разработчика — миссия (почти) невыполнима? 

Mango sticker

Дефицит скилловых кандидатов

У Blockchain-разработчиков есть кое-что общее с экзотическими фруктами: как и в случае с фруктами, найти разработчика блокчейна — не так просто. Манго не растет в каждом дворике, а блокчейн-разработчики не тусуются на job-бордах и их довольно сложно захантить в LinkedIn.

Кроме того, на некоторые фрукты могут просто не подойти вам из-за индивидуальной непереносимости. Не зная, что именно вы ищете и не предоставляя качественное тестовое задание для айтишников, скорее всего, вы наймете новичка или нерелевантного кандидата вместо скиллового специалиста.

No sticker

Многие специалисты уже заняты на других проектах

Рынок блокчейн-проектов постоянно увеличивается (спад небольшой по сравнению с периодом пандемии), как и объемы инвестиций в него, поэтому блокчейн-разработчики сегодня в дефиците. Get in the line!

Money sticker

Высокий рейт/зарплата

Зарплата блокчейн-разработчика — болезненная тема для работодателей. Вилка зависит от страны и региона, но не стоит ожидать, что зарплата блокчейн-специалиста будет значительно ниже $5–13 тыс. По данным специализированного сайта web3.career, часовой рейт разработчиков варьируется от $31 до $130. 

«Кроме зарплаты, для кандидатов в блокчейн-сфере важен и сам проект — чтобы это было не что-то созданное на хайпе, а создавалось впечатление уникальности, важности проекта. И, конечно, критичным становится надежное финансирование продукта. Настоящий челлендж — показать, что у специалиста будут гарантии на проекте и возможность долговременного сотрудничества». Николай Клестов, CTO и co-founder в ITExpert

Кроме того, даже если вам удастся самостоятельно найти заинтересованного блокчейн-разработчика, как вы узнаете, что он вам подходит? Как оценить навыки, опыт и портфолио? Вам придется либо довериться найденному вами разработчику блокчейна, либо углубиться в тему и потратить долгие часы на скрининг.

Наймите Blockchain-разработчика с опытной командой ITExpert

Конечно, на таких платформах, как Upwork или Freelancer, полно разработчиков блокчейна. Но доверите ли вы такой сложный и секьюрный проект случайному человеку? Мы здесь, чтобы помочь вам быстро найти скилловых и надежных специалистов на full- или part-time 💫 Для этого мы вовлекаем в процесс команду tech-рекрутеров, а также технического специалиста, который тщательно скринит каждого кандидата.

Специалисты IT-рекрутингового агентства ITExpert с 2015 года нанимают tech/non-tech IT-специалистов для компаний в Украине и по всему миру: от США до Израиля. Среди наших клиентов — Sony, Deloitte и Depositphotos.

Преимущества

Закрываем самые сложные вакансии в сфере IT:
нам доверяют компании из 17+ стран мира, потому что мы показываем результат.

Релевантные кандидаты:
наш CTO помогает настроить точный поиск.

Опытные рекрутеры:
у нас есть кейсы и бэкграунд в разных нишах и доменах — мы знаем, каких кандидатов вы ищете.

Быстрый найм:
показываем первых релевантных кандидатов уже через 2–3 дня после начала поисков.

Гарантия:
ищем замену кандидату, если специалист не пройдет испытательный срок.

Мы поможем выявить bottleneckʼи в рекрутинговых процессах и исправить их, чтобы успешно закрыть вакансию. Проведем аналитику рынка по профилю блокчейн, определим вилку заработных плат, оптимизируем стадии отбора и найдем кандидатов с опытом в разработке блокчейнов и владением Python, Java, Typescript, Solidity или других языков и технологий.

Скажите «нет» бесконечному просмотру резюме и сомнительным профилями кандидатов. Наймите специалиста Senior-уровня и начните создавать новое поколение блокчейн-решений уже сейчас!

*Blockchain technology cloud market size forecast for 2030

    Заказать консультацию по IT-рекрутингу

    FAQ
    Когда я получу первые резюме Blockchain-разработчика?
    Мы покажем вам первые резюме уже через 2–3 дня после начала поисков. У команды ITExpert есть горячая база кандидатов на разные направления, доступ к нишевым ресурсам и опыт в найме Blockchain-разработчиков — мы сможем показать вам быстрый результат!
    Сколько нужно резюме, чтобы сделать оффер Blockchain-разработчику?
    В среднем нужно семь резюме от нашей команды, чтобы успешно закрыть позицию. Однако все зависит от ваших процессов и уверенности в том, что вы нашли своего кандидата. Иногда джоб оффер дают уже после первого собеседования.
    Как быстро ITExpert закрывает вакансию Blockchain-разработчика?
    Мы усиливаем вашу команду и сокращаем найм до 22–26 дней. Но в нашем портфеле есть и звездные кейсы, когда позицию закрывали уже через два дня поиска. Поделитесь вашими целями и дедлайнами, а мы гибко под них подстроимся.
    Полезные статьи
    blank
    Вы не сможете делегировать рекрутинг «под ключ» — и вот почему
    blank
    Зачем CTO в команде рекрутеров
    blank
    Как составить портрет кандидата: 15 вопросов
    up